In a significant legal development in the Greek city of Chalandri, a pharmacist and eight other individuals have been released under strict conditions following their appearances before the court regarding allegations of operating an illegal underground laboratory producing anabolic steroids and other prohibited substances. The accused pharmacist, who was reportedly accompanied by his legal counsel during the hearing, was ordered to appear regularly at the local police station and pay a bail of 50,000 euros. This decision comes after he presented his defense, arguing that the production process was entirely legal.

The remaining eight defendants were also released on similar terms, although one among them was required to post a smaller bail of 1,000 euros. All of these individuals are now subject to restrictions aimed at ensuring their presence throughout the ongoing judicial proceedings. These measures reflect the gravity of the charges against them, which include the unauthorized manufacturing and distribution of pharmaceutical products deemed harmful to public health by the National Organization for Medicines (EOF).

The investigation into this case began with a police operation conducted on June 9th, which led to the arrest of 14 individuals. Among those arrested was the alleged leader of the organization, identified as a 51-year-old man who owns a pharmacy in Chalandri. During the raid, authorities seized large quantities of raw materials and finished products, all of which were classified as dangerous for end-users by the EOF.

According to reports, the group had been active since at least January 2024, forming a structured network dedicated to the production and trafficking of both medicinal compounds and doping agents. The operation took place within the basement of the accused pharmacist's store, where comprehensive laboratory equipment was installed without proper authorization from regulatory bodies. This setup allowed for the clandestine creation of substances such as weight-loss pills and anabolic steroids, which were then distributed illegally across the market.

As the legal process unfolds, the accused individuals will face serious charges related to the storage, transportation, and sale of banned substances. Their upcoming testimonies are anticipated to be lengthy, given the complexity and severity of the allegations they must address. Meanwhile, the public remains concerned about the potential impact of such activities on consumer safety and the integrity of the healthcare system.

The release of these individuals under conditional freedom highlights the balance between ensuring justice and allowing for fair trial procedures. As the case progresses, further developments are expected, including additional evidence presentation and possibly more arrests linked to this illicit enterprise. The outcome of this trial could set important precedents concerning the regulation and enforcement of laws governing pharmaceutical practices in Greece.
